Show Notes

Of course we want our children to play. Who doesn’t? But how many of you are willing to let them play the way they want to—and need to? Parents are too quick to jump in and supervise in well-intentioned efforts to teach children right from wrong, how to be “nice”, and how not to be selfish. But do these intentions fit with a child’s normal developmental processes? Children’s play has become more and more supervised and externally directed. The result can be dire for later learning and discipline issues in our youth.
